Painting Contest on India 1947 vs India 2047

As a part of the Independence Day Celebrations 2026, the Ministry of Defence, in collaboration with MyGov, invites citizens to participate in a Painting Competition on the theme “ India 1947 vs India 2047“. This initiative aims to raise awareness about the recent developments and achievements of our nation, showcasing India’s progress across key sectors. From advancements in science and technology to strides in infrastructure, education, and defence, this competition offers a platform for artists to creatively depict the spirit of a strong, self-reliant India.

Participation Guidelines:

Participants are to showcase paintings on the theme ” India 1947 vs India 2047″ depicting recent developments and achievements of India.

Gratifications:
1. Top 3 short listed winners will be awarded prize money of Rs. 15,000/- each.
2. 20 Consolation winners will be awarded prize money of Rs. 5000/- each.
3. Top 200 participants along with one companion (spouse/guardian/relative etc.) would be issued e-invitation to witness Independence Day Celebration to be held on 15th August, 2026 at Red Fort, Delhi.

Kindly Note : Competition is being simultaneously held on MyGov as well as MyBharat platform. A single combined result of winners will be issued for both the platforms i.e. MyGov and MyBharat. Participants are required to participate in only of these platforms.
